Summary
Just a moment ago on the cosmic scale, a living creature began to wonder who it was, where it had come from, and where it might be going. Thousands of years of evolutionary progress have delivered the human species to this precise moment today when each act of individual improvement contributes to a new stage of evolution, a new kind of existence of earth.At a time when the need for spiritual connection and hope in the world is profound, God and the Evolving Universe portrays a new vision of human possibility. Our ordinary way of being in the world can suddenly blossom into the extraordinary. Daily awakenings-those brief glimpses of a higher intelligence, of a destiny that wants to be actualized in us-become the stuff of compelling shifts to a larger sense of self. Inner wakefulness will lead to discoveries about our untapped capacities for extraordinary life.A bold new work that unites the planetary and the personal in one broad stroke, God and the Evolving Universe describes a human species that is evolving by small and large steps toward epochal change. Global perspectives of evolutionary change paired with exercises that help readers develop their personal abilities create the foundation for transcendence to the next level of human potential.
